104 Deputy Olivia Mitchell asked the Minister for Finance if he will consider exempting from VAT the personal domestic home paging system for the deaf (details supplied) to make it affordable for those who do not qualify for the seniors alert scheme under which the qualifying elderly receive it completely free of charge;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[17861/12]
